Backup vs Archive vs Disaster Recovery (What Businesses Should Know)

Backup vs Archive vs Disaster Recovery (What Businesses Should Know)

Have you ever been locked out of an important folder or realized a colleague accidentally deleted a key client file? Maybe you’ve faced a hardware crash or a sudden power outage. These glitches are part of daily work life. While each situation involves your business data, they aren’t all the same and they shouldn’t be handled the same way. One morning you might just need to grab a file you edited an hour ago. Another day, you might need a record from five years back. And in a worst case scenario, you might need to get your entire business back on its feet after a major disaster. This is why mixing up backup, archive and disaster recovery is risky.

5 Best Practices for Securing OneDrive Data in 2026 (Part One)

5 Best Practices for Securing OneDrive Data in 2026 (Part One)

As organizations increasingly rely on OneDrive for critical business operations, it is essential to shift from a mindset of passive cloud reliance to active resilience. This document argues that cloud storage is not synonymous with data protection and highlights the necessity of implementing a robust safety net to mitigate risks such as accidental deletions, ransomware, and human error.
